Networking service check

Note: Before starting this service check, print out the network setup page. This page is found under Menu -
Reports - Network Settings. Consult the network administrator to verify that the physical and wireless network
settings displayed on the network settings page for the device are properly configured. If a wireless network is
used, verify that the printer is in range of the host computer or wireless access point, and there is no electronic
interference. Have the network administrator verify that the device is using the correct SSID, and wireless
security protocols. For more network troubleshooting information, consult the Lexmark Network Setup Guide.
